Hello I have an 1988 mustang GT 5.0.... It runs great BUT I am having trouble getting it to idle. It idles high then low then high and then tries to die . You can also hear it misfiring and the plugs get fowled up after a while Any thoughts on what could be wrong. Would an EGR or O2 sensor do this?

Last major tune-up? could be the idle speed control/throttle body coked-up/throttle position and MAP/BARO sensor.

Or fuel pressure problem
